Corsair carbide 330R.

https://www.corsair.com/us/en/Categories/Products/Cases/Carbide-Series™-330R-Quiet-Mid-Tower-Case/p/CC-9011024-WW

Although, there really aren't any benefits to a front door. It restricts airflow, so the "quiet" aspect advertised is not really gonna happen, since the fans will have to work harder and spin faster to cool your system.
